Web27 jan. 2024 · A 26 Foot Truck. It’s a box truck measuring 26 ft. (7.9 m) in length and weighing 26,000 GVW, it falls under Class 6 gross vehicle weight rating. Its dimension (LWH) is 26’ x 8’ 1” x 8’ 1” (1,698 cubic feet). With nearly 1,700 cubic feet of cargo space, it can hail up to 10,000 lbs. Their rear doors roll up like garage doors.

While their trailers are rated at a tad over 5900#, they will require you to tell them what type of vehicle you are hauling on their trailer so they can look in their database to get a weight estimate ... churchill flint miWeb16 dec. 2024 · Specs and dimensions of a Uhaul 10 ft Box Truck. A Uhaul 10-ft truck has the following Specs and dimensions: Inside Dimensions: 9’11” x 6’2″ x 6’4″ (LxWxH) Deck Height from Ground: 29″. Door Opening: 5’11” x 5’7″ (WxH) Max Load: 2,850 lbs.
